Premier League clubs have agreed to allow all top-flight matches to be shown live on TV this month.
The U-turn has been made following a meeting between officials from all 20 clubs in the division and pressure from the government over the issue after a fan backlash prompted an intervention.

Seventeen of the matches were already scheduled for broadcast but the league has confirmed that the remaining 11 will be too.

The league said the existing rights holders – Sky Sports, BT Sport, Amazon and the BBC – would screen the games.

Naija news Understands that the decision was taken with the 2020/21 season prepares to get under way this weekend, with no fans in attendance due to COVID-19 social distancing restrictions still in place.

The government is working towards allowing some spectators back into stadiums from the start of next month, albeit with grounds still well below capacity.

Initially stadiums are expected to be one third full at best.
